Subject: DR drill Thursday — weather-alert fan-out

Hi support crew,

Quick heads-up: Thursday we're running the disaster-recovery drill for Gustline's weather-alert fan-out. Expect test pushes tagged DRILL in the Marwick region queue — don't escalate those. If the fan-out console locks you out mid-drill, use the standby recovery account. You'll need the passphrase for it, which is right below.

recovery phrase for fawif-tajeg: norael-aldmir-casir-brivan-ulaion

Handover — Skylark SDK parity

Taking over parity work between the Skylark Kotlin and Swift SDKs. Kotlin has retry batching and offline queueing; Swift doesn't yet, so the Veldt backend compensates with a per-platform config overlay. Don't remove that overlay until Swift ships queueing. If paging fires on parity mismatches, check the overlay first. The current overlay values are below.

deployment values, tafof-taduf:
pelius:
  pin: 6508
  tenant: praiel
  seal: seal_4e33a2f4
  metrics_host: metrics.pelius.plorvagrid.corp
  standby_team: druix
  escalation: juldor-norius
  nonce: 5db598

The Lattice public REST API uses cursor-based pagination; every list response includes a `next_cursor` field, and clients must pass it back unchanged. When investigating reports of missing or duplicated records, walk the full cursor chain manually and compare totals against the internal reconciliation service, which exposes authoritative counts per collection. Never paginate by offset against production data — results shift under concurrent writes. To query the reconciliation service during your investigation, authenticate with the key below.

API key for yahig-tadup: kto7_ubizbYm

## Add adaptive rate limiting to Perchgate edge tier

This PR introduces per-client token buckets in the Perchgate gateway, replacing the fixed global throttle that caused the cascading 429s during last week's Harvold traffic spike. Buckets refill on a sliding window, and the limiter now degrades gracefully when the quota store is unreachable by falling back to conservative local limits. On-call: please review the fallback path carefully before approving. The constants chosen after load testing are listed below.

limits module of tafop-hahop:
WEIGHTS = {
    "julmir": 223,
    "belox": 987,
    "lamion": 470,
    "pelath": 609,
    "fraok": 1010,
    "eliion": 343,
    "drudor": 342,
}